Accès aux informations d'une zone de maillage. Plus de détails...
#include <arcane/core/MeshAreaAccessor.h>
Fonctions membres publiques | |
MeshAreaAccessor (IMeshArea *mesh_area) | |
IMeshArea * | meshArea () |
Zone de maillage accédée par cette accessor. | |
void | setMeshArea (IMeshArea *mesh_area) |
Positionne à mesh_area la zone de maillage accédée par cette accessor. | |
Integer | nbNode () |
Nombre de noeuds du maillage. | |
Integer | nbCell () |
Nombre de mailles du maillage. | |
NodeGroup | allNodes () |
Groupe de tous les noeuds de la zone. | |
CellGroup | allCells () |
Groupe de toutes les mailles de la zone. | |
NodeGroup | ownNodes () |
Groupe de tous les noeuds propres de la zone. | |
CellGroup | ownCells () |
Groupe de toutes les mailles propres de la zone. | |
Attributs privés | |
IMeshArea * | m_mesh_area |
Accès aux informations d'une zone de maillage.
Définition à la ligne 36 du fichier MeshAreaAccessor.h.
Arcane::MeshAreaAccessor::MeshAreaAccessor | ( | IMeshArea * | mesh_area | ) |
Définition à la ligne 28 du fichier MeshAreaAccessor.cc.
Arcane::MeshAreaAccessor::~MeshAreaAccessor | ( | ) |
Définition à la ligne 37 du fichier MeshAreaAccessor.cc.
CellGroup Arcane::MeshAreaAccessor::allCells | ( | ) |
Groupe de toutes les mailles de la zone.
Définition à la ligne 81 du fichier MeshAreaAccessor.cc.
NodeGroup Arcane::MeshAreaAccessor::allNodes | ( | ) |
Groupe de tous les noeuds de la zone.
Définition à la ligne 75 du fichier MeshAreaAccessor.cc.
IMeshArea * Arcane::MeshAreaAccessor::meshArea | ( | ) |
Zone de maillage accédée par cette accessor.
Définition à la ligne 51 du fichier MeshAreaAccessor.cc.
Integer Arcane::MeshAreaAccessor::nbCell | ( | ) |
Nombre de mailles du maillage.
Définition à la ligne 66 du fichier MeshAreaAccessor.cc.
Integer Arcane::MeshAreaAccessor::nbNode | ( | ) |
Nombre de noeuds du maillage.
Définition à la ligne 60 du fichier MeshAreaAccessor.cc.
CellGroup Arcane::MeshAreaAccessor::ownCells | ( | ) |
Groupe de toutes les mailles propres de la zone.
Définition à la ligne 96 du fichier MeshAreaAccessor.cc.
NodeGroup Arcane::MeshAreaAccessor::ownNodes | ( | ) |
Groupe de tous les noeuds propres de la zone.
Définition à la ligne 90 du fichier MeshAreaAccessor.cc.
Positionne à mesh_area la zone de maillage accédée par cette accessor.
Définition à la ligne 45 du fichier MeshAreaAccessor.cc.
|
private |
Définition à la ligne 75 du fichier MeshAreaAccessor.h.